"Searchin'" is a song written by Jerry Leiber and Mike Stoller specifically for the Coasters. Atco Records released it as a single in March 1957, which topped the R&B Chart for twelve weeks. It also reached number three on the Billboard singles chart.

Although the Coasters had previously done well on the rhythm and blues charts, "Searchin'" (along with "Young Blood" on the flip side) sparked the group's rock and roll fame.
